Suite

Règle maperitive par source


J'essaie de créer mes propres tuiles pour OpenStreemMaps mais avec un look plus "Google Maps".

Après avoir longtemps joué avec les propriétés de la règle, j'ai enfin le look que je veux mais j'ai un problème.

Les données que Maperitive télécharge dans l'option de l'API Overpass sont excellentes, mais pour une raison quelconque, elles ne rendent pas l'océan, ou du moins "Rio de la Plata" qui est la rivière la plus large (mais je ne pense pas que ce soit un problème de rivière car d'autres rivières rendent très bien).

L'option XAPI rend la côte et l'océan très bien, mais il manque certaines données. Ces tuiles sont pour un projet d'ONG et nous utilisons OSM car nous avons ajouté des rues de bidonvilles. Je ne sais pas si c'est parce que c'est obsolète ou quoi, mais XAPI n'a pas ces rues, nous avons ajouté le projet OSM.

Si j'ajoute les deux sources en tant que couches différentes, j'obtiens à la fois les nouvelles rues et l'océan, mais le texte du nom de la route diffère plusieurs fois de sa position, ce qui rend le texte "fantôme". Si je pouvais appliquer une règle à la source/couche XAPI dans laquelle il n'y a pas de texte et mettre en haut la source/couche Overpass, je pourrais obtenir la carte parfaite, mais lorsque je modifie une règle, elle s'applique à toutes les sources.

Existe-t-il un moyen d'avoir une règle différente par source ? Peut-être, mais probablement pas.

Merci


Si les options de téléchargement intégrées (XAPI et Overpass) n'affichent pas les données que vous vous attendez à voir ou qu'elles présentent des erreurs avec les polystyrènes aquatiques, vous pouvez télécharger le fichier .pbf le plus récent pour votre région (depuis geofabrik ou l'un les autres fournisseurs) et l'importer dans maperative. De cette façon, vous pouvez renoncer au processus de téléchargement des données et diffuser les données localement à partir de votre fichier pbf téléchargé.

Espérons que cela puisse résoudre vos deux problèmes de ne pas obtenir de polys complets et de ne pas obtenir les données OSM actuelles !


Voir la vidéo: Setup own OpenStreetMap tileserver with vector and raster tiles (Octobre 2021).